For them it has been years since Arthur and his friends were transported to the Realm of Ark. But after a while, Arthur found a way to go home. Depleting most of their energy to build a portal home, but it came at a cost for all of them. Arthur released a Orb of Essensce, the main driving force of magic in the Realm of Ark to stablize his friends and himself so their power didn't overtake their minds. A woman appeared infront of Arthur telling him a prophecy that would occur due to his actions alone, the women was of great importance to him but he had not a single memory of her. And many of his and his friends memory of the Realm of Ark have been locked away.
